次日黎明的時候, 神安排一條蟲子,蛀蝕這棵蓖麻,蓖麻就枯槁了。 日出的時候, 神又安排炎熱的東風。烈日曬在約拿的頭上,以致發昏,他就為自己求死,說:“我死了比活著還好。”

 神問約拿:“你因這棵蓖麻這樣發怒,對不對呢?”約拿說:“我發怒以至於死都是對的。”

But at dawn the next day God provided a worm, which chewed the plant so that it withered.(A) When the sun rose, God provided a scorching east wind, and the sun blazed on Jonah’s head so that he grew faint. He wanted to die,(B) and said, “It would be better for me to die than to live.”

But God said to Jonah, “Is it right for you to be angry about the plant?”(C)

“It is,” he said. “And I’m so angry I wish I were dead.”
